<h2>Answer: India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Nepal, Bhutan, Sri Lanka and Maldives</h2>

The Indian subcontinent (also called South Asia) is the geographical region that is currently divided among the states of India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Nepal and Bhutan. However, for cultural and geographical reasons, the island states of Sri Lanka and Maldives are also considered part of this subcontinent.

This landmass, which is a peninsula in the southern region of Asia, is mostly situated on the Indian Plate. In this sense, it is considered a subcontinent because it belongs to a continent, but is smaller compared to a continent.  

Nevertheless, this region is part of a distinct landmass that was originally larger, but after the separations due to the movement of tectonic plates, it became part of Asia.

The leaves of plants in a chaparral
Evgesh-ka [11]

Answer:

are covered with sticky resin

Explanation:

The chaparral can be found in the southwestern part of the United States and in the northwestern part of Mexico. It is perfectly evolved for surviving in hot and dry conditions. In order to be able to survive in the hot and dry environment, as well as protect itself from the herbivores, the chaparral has managed to develop an excellent adaptation that serves for multiple purposes. The leaves are covered in sticky resin. This sticky resin is able to screen the leaves against the ultraviolet radiation. It also manages to stop the loss of water, as well as putting away the herbivores as they find it toxic and disgusting.
